Excel移位运算符是什么?如何正确使用?
作者:佚名|分类:EXCEL|浏览:53|发布时间:2025-03-17 11:05:21
Excel移位运算符是什么?如何正确使用?
在Excel中,移位运算符是一种非常有用的功能,它允许用户对数字进行位移操作,这在处理二进制数据或进行数学计算时特别有用。以下是关于Excel移位运算符的详细介绍。
一、什么是Excel移位运算符?
Excel移位运算符包括左移位()两种。它们用于将数字的二进制表示向左或向右移动指定的位数。
左移位():将数字的二进制表示向右移动指定的位数,每向右移动一位,相当于原数字除以2的位数次方。
二、如何正确使用Excel移位运算符?
1. 左移位()
假设我们有一个数字8000,我们想将其右移3位。
原始数字:8000(二进制:10000000000)
右移3位:1000(二进制)
在Excel中,我们可以使用以下公式来实现:
```excel
=8000 >> 3
```
这将返回结果10。
三、注意事项
1. 移位运算符只适用于整数。
2. 移位运算符的结果可能会超出Excel的数值范围,导致错误。
3. 在进行移位运算时,应确保移动的位数不超过数字的二进制位数。
四、示例
以下是一些使用移位运算符的示例:
将数字5左移2位:5 2 = 5
将数字-5左移2位:-5 2 = -5
五、相关问答
相关问答1:移位运算符在Excel中有什么实际应用?
移位运算符在Excel中可以用于多种应用,例如:
二进制转换:将十进制数转换为二进制数,或进行二进制运算。
数据压缩:通过移位操作减少数据的位数,从而实现数据压缩。
数学计算:在数学公式中,移位运算符可以用于简化计算。
相关问答2:移位运算符是否可以用于小数?
不,移位运算符只适用于整数。如果尝试对小数使用移位运算符,Excel将返回错误。
相关问答3:移位运算符是否可以用于负数?
是的,移位运算符可以用于负数。对于负数,移位运算符的行为与正数相同,只是结果也会是负数。
相关问答4:移位运算符的优先级如何?
移位运算符的优先级高于乘法和除法,但低于加法和减法。这意味着在表达式中,移位运算符会先于乘法和除法执行。
通过以上内容,相信大家对Excel移位运算符有了更深入的了解。正确使用移位运算符可以帮助我们在Excel中进行更复杂的数学计算和数据操作。